Before you begin cutting, it’s important to wear appropriate safety gear, including gloves, safety glasses, and a dust mask. Galvanized metal can produce sharp edges and release metal dust, so it’s crucial to protect yourself from any potential hazards. Additionally, ensure that your work area is well-ventilated to avoid inhaling harmful fumes. Furthermore, choose the right cutting tool for the job. While there are various options available, such as aviation snips, nibblers, and power shears, selecting the most suitable tool for the thickness and shape of the sheet you’re working with is essential.

When cutting galvanized metal sheets, it’s important to use sharp blades or cutting tools. Dull blades can cause the metal to tear or become uneven, compromising the integrity of the cut and potentially increasing the risk of injury. Additionally, using the appropriate cutting technique is crucial. For straight cuts, use aviation snips or power shears, ensuring that the blade is perpendicular to the metal’s surface. For curved or intricate cuts, nibblers or jigsaws can provide greater precision and control. Regardless of the cutting method you choose, always secure the metal sheet firmly in place before cutting to prevent it from moving or slipping.

Gather Necessary Tools and Safety Gear

Before embarking on the task of cutting galvanized metal sheets, it is crucial to ensure that you have gathered all the necessary tools and safety gear to ensure a safe and efficient experience.

Essential Tools

The following tools will be indispensable for cutting galvanized metal sheets:

  • Tin snips (aviation snips): These specialized scissors are designed for precision cutting of thin metal sheets.
  • Jigsaw with metal-cutting blade: A jigsaw provides greater flexibility and control when cutting intricate shapes or curves.
  • Reciprocating saw with metal-cutting blade: This tool delivers power and efficiency for straight cuts on thicker metal sheets.
  • Angle grinder with metal-cutting disc: An angle grinder offers versatility for cutting through multiple layers or making precise angle cuts.
  • Clamps: These are essential for securing the metal sheets firmly in place while cutting.
  • Metal file: A metal file is used to smooth and refine the edges of cut metal pieces.

Safety Gear

Prioritizing safety is paramount when handling galvanized metal sheets. Therefore, it is mandatory to wear appropriate protective gear:

  • Safety glasses: These are essential to shield your eyes from flying metal chips.
  • Gloves: Wear heavy-duty gloves to protect your hands from sharp edges.
  • Dust mask: A dust mask is crucial to prevent inhaling harmful metal particles.
  • Ear protection: Prolonged exposure to the noise generated by power tools requires earplugs or earmuffs.
  • Long-sleeve clothing: Wear long-sleeved clothing to minimize skin exposure to metal shavings.
  • Proper footwear: Wear closed-toe, non-slip shoes to ensure stability and prevent injuries.

Deburr and Smooth Edges

After cutting galvanized metal sheets, it’s crucial to deburr and smooth the edges to prevent injury, enhance safety, and optimize the sheet’s performance. Here’s a detailed guide on how to do it:

1. Wear Protective Gear: Start by donning safety glasses, gloves, and appropriate clothing to protect yourself from sharp edges and flying metal particles.

2. Identify the Burr: Locate the area where the metal has been cut, and examine the edges carefully. The burr is the jagged, rough portion extending beyond the intended line of the cut.

3. Use a Deburring Tool: Select a deburring tool like a file or a deburring brush. Gently run the tool along the edge at a 45-degree angle. Avoid applying excessive pressure to prevent damage to the metal.

4. File and Sand the Edges: Alternatively, you can use a file or sandpaper to remove the burr. Hold the file or sandpaper perpendicular to the edge and gently move it in a circular motion. Repeat until the edges are smooth and free of rough spots.

5. Use a Grinder (Optional): If the burr is particularly significant, you can utilize a grinder. However, use it cautiously to avoid generating excessive heat or damaging the metal. Keep the grinder at a low speed and guide it carefully along the edges.

6. Inspect and Check: After deburring, thoroughly inspect the edges to ensure all rough areas have been removed. Run your fingers along the edges to check for any remaining burrs or sharp protrusions.

7. Round the Edges (Optional): For enhanced safety and aesthetics, consider rounding the edges using a curved file or a grinding wheel. This helps prevent snags and uncomfortable handling, particularly when working with sheets that will be exposed or used for certain applications.

Deburring Method Advantages Disadvantages
File Precise, allows for localized deburring Manual effort required, time-consuming
Deburring Brush Fast, removes large burrs May not be suitable for delicate edges
Grinder Efficient, removes heavy burrs Can generate heat, requires skill to use

How to Cut Galvanized Metal Sheets

When working with galvanized metal sheets, it is important to know how to cut them properly to avoid damage or injury. The following are the steps involved in cutting galvanized metal sheets:

  1. Wear safety gear, including gloves, safety glasses, and earplugs.

  2. Mark the metal sheet where you want to cut.

  3. Use a sharp pair of metal shears or a circular saw equipped with a metal cutting blade.

  4. Cut along the marked line, using firm, even pressure.

  5. File or sand any sharp edges to prevent injury.

Additional tips for cutting galvanized metal sheets include:

  • Use a lubricant, such as WD-40, to reduce friction and prevent the blade from sticking.

  • Clamp the metal sheet down to a stable surface before cutting to prevent it from moving.

  • Clean the cut edges of the metal sheet to remove any debris or galvanizing dust.
